*{box-sizing:border-box}:root{color:#fff;background:#020617;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}body{background:#020617;min-width:320px;margin:0}a{color:inherit;text-decoration:none}button,input,select,textarea{font:inherit}button{cursor:pointer}.site{color:#fff;min-height:100vh;position:relative;overflow-x:hidden}.background-glow{z-index:-1;filter:blur(90px);opacity:.35;border-radius:999px;width:24rem;height:24rem;position:fixed}.glow-one{background:#06b6d4;top:-10rem;left:-10rem}.glow-two{background:#7c3aed;top:10rem;right:-10rem}.glow-three{opacity:.18;background:#2563eb;bottom:-10rem;left:28%}.header{z-index:50;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:#020617d1;border-bottom:1px solid #ffffff1a;position:sticky;top:0}.nav-wrap{justify-content:space-between;align-items:center;gap:18px;max-width:1180px;margin:0 auto;padding:16px 20px;display:flex}.brand{align-items:center;gap:12px;display:flex}.brand strong{font-size:18px;line-height:1.1;display:block}.brand small{color:#94a3b8;margin-top:3px;font-size:12px;display:block}.logo-box{background:#000;border:1px solid #ffffff1f;border-radius:18px;place-items:center;width:52px;height:52px;display:grid;overflow:hidden;box-shadow:0 12px 35px #22d3ee2e}.logo-box img{object-fit:contain;width:100%;height:100%;padding:4px}.desktop-nav{align-items:center;gap:8px;display:flex}.desktop-nav a,.mobile-nav a{color:#cbd5e1;border-radius:999px;padding:10px 15px;font-size:14px;font-weight:600;transition:all .2s}.desktop-nav a:hover,.mobile-nav a:hover{color:#fff;background:#ffffff1a}.desktop-nav a.active,.mobile-nav a.active{color:#020617;background:#fff}.menu-btn{color:#fff;background:0 0;border:0;display:none}.mobile-nav{border-top:1px solid #ffffff1a;padding:0 20px 16px;display:none}.container{max-width:1180px;margin:0 auto;padding:56px 20px 72px}.hero{grid-template-columns:1.08fr .92fr;align-items:center;gap:44px;display:grid}.fade-in{animation:.5s both fadeIn}@keyframes fadeIn{0%{opacity:0;transform:translateY(18px)}to{opacity:1;transform:translateY(0)}}.pill{color:#a5f3fc;background:#22d3ee1a;border:1px solid #22d3ee4d;border-radius:999px;align-items:center;gap:8px;margin-bottom:22px;padding:9px 14px;font-size:14px;font-weight:700;display:inline-flex}h1{letter-spacing:-.06em;margin:0;font-size:clamp(38px,7vw,66px);line-height:.98}h2{letter-spacing:-.04em;margin:8px 0 26px;font-size:clamp(30px,4vw,44px)}h3{color:#fff}.hero-copy p,.lead{color:#cbd5e1;max-width:680px;font-size:18px;line-height:1.75}.hero-actions{flex-wrap:wrap;gap:12px;margin-top:28px;display:flex}.primary-btn,.secondary-btn{border:0;border-radius:18px;justify-content:center;align-items:center;gap:9px;min-height:52px;padding:0 22px;font-weight:800;display:inline-flex}.primary-btn{color:#020617;background:#22d3ee}.primary-btn:hover{background:#67e8f9}.secondary-btn{color:#fff;background:#ffffff0d;border:1px solid #ffffff29}.secondary-btn:hover{background:#ffffff1a}.preview-card,.card,.feature-strip,.article-card,.contact-card,.form-card{-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:#ffffff17;border:1px solid #ffffff1a;box-shadow:0 24px 70px #00000038}.preview-card{border-radius:34px;padding:24px}.browser-card{background:#0f172a;border:1px solid #ffffff1a;border-radius:26px;padding:24px}.browser-dots{gap:8px;margin-bottom:28px;display:flex}.browser-dots span{border-radius:999px;width:12px;height:12px}.browser-dots span:first-child{background:#f87171}.browser-dots span:nth-child(2){background:#facc15}.browser-dots span:nth-child(3){background:#4ade80}.mock-hero{background:linear-gradient(135deg,#22d3ee4d,#7c3aed4d);border-radius:22px;height:100px;padding:20px}.mock-hero div{background:#ffffff8c;border-radius:999px;height:11px;margin-bottom:12px}.mock-hero div:first-child{width:32%}.mock-hero div:nth-child(2){opacity:.6;width:62%}.mock-hero div:nth-child(3){opacity:.3;width:44%}.mock-grid{grid-template-columns:1fr 1fr;gap:14px;margin-top:16px;display:grid}.mock-grid div{color:#67e8f9;background:#ffffff14;border-radius:22px;height:120px;padding:18px}.mock-grid span{background:#ffffff59;border-radius:999px;width:60%;height:9px;margin-top:36px;display:block}.mock-banner{color:#020617;background:#22d3ee;border-radius:22px;margin-top:16px;padding:18px}.mock-banner strong,.mock-banner small{display:block}.mock-banner small{opacity:.72;margin-top:4px}.section-block{margin-top:84px}.eyebrow{color:#67e8f9;letter-spacing:.14em;text-transform:uppercase;margin:0;font-size:13px;font-weight:800}.service-grid{grid-template-columns:repeat(3,1fr);gap:18px;display:grid}.card{border-radius:28px;padding:26px}.card p,.article-card p,.article-card li{color:#cbd5e1;line-height:1.8}.icon-circle{color:#67e8f9;background:#22d3ee24;border-radius:18px;place-items:center;width:52px;height:52px;margin-bottom:16px;display:grid}.feature-strip{border-radius:32px;grid-template-columns:repeat(3,1fr);gap:24px;margin-top:70px;padding:30px;display:grid}.feature-strip div{color:#e2e8f0;align-items:center;gap:10px;display:flex}.content-grid,.contact-grid{grid-template-columns:.85fr 1.15fr;gap:36px;display:grid}.content-layout h1,.contact-grid h1{font-size:clamp(36px,5vw,54px)}.article-card,.form-card,.contact-card{border-radius:32px;padding:30px}.article-card h3{margin-top:28px}.contact-card p{color:#cbd5e1;margin:14px 0}.contact-card strong{color:#fff}.form-card{gap:18px;display:grid}.form-card label{color:#cbd5e1;gap:9px;font-weight:700;display:grid}.form-card input,.form-card select,.form-card textarea{color:#fff;background:#0f172a;border:1px solid #ffffff1a;border-radius:18px;outline:none;width:100%;padding:14px 16px}.form-card textarea{resize:vertical;min-height:130px}.form-card input:focus,.form-card select:focus,.form-card textarea:focus{border-color:#22d3ee;box-shadow:0 0 0 3px #22d3ee2e}.full-width{width:100%}.footer{text-align:center;color:#94a3b8;border-top:1px solid #ffffff1a;padding:28px 20px;font-size:14px}.footer p{margin:6px 0}@media (width<=860px){.desktop-nav{display:none}.menu-btn{display:inline-flex}.mobile-nav{gap:10px;display:grid}.mobile-nav a{background:#ffffff0d;border-radius:16px}.hero,.content-grid,.contact-grid,.service-grid,.feature-strip{grid-template-columns:1fr}.container{padding-top:34px}.brand small{display:none}}
